The Hidden Costs of Poor Christian Time Management

Most people think of wasted time as scrolling social media or binge-watching shows. But the real issue is deeper—it’s the small, hidden distractions that drain our hours without us even realizing it. Learning how to stop wasting time can help with this.

Christian time management isn’t about working harder—it’s about working with intention and recognizing where time is slipping away.

Tiny Time Leaks That Steal Your Focus

Ever check your phone for “just a second” and somehow lose 20 minutes? These small distractions add up quickly and keep you from focusing on what truly matters.

Faith-based time management means setting intentional boundaries—like using the 10-minute rule to stay on track when distractions hit. Knowing how to stop wasting time is crucial here.

Mental Overload: The Reason You Feel Scattered

If your brain feels like a web browser with too many tabs open, you’re not alone. The constant mental to-do list slows you down and makes everything feel overwhelming.

The key to Christian time management? Offloading the mental clutter. We talk about a brain dump strategy that will help you regain focus and clarity. This can be part of learning how to stop wasting time.

The Cost of Indecision & Overthinking

Decision fatigue is real. The more choices we make each day, the harder it gets to make the next one—until even small decisions feel overwhelming.

That’s why effective time stewardship includes setting simple decision-making strategies to avoid overthinking. We break down a 2-minute rule to help you move forward faster.

Reactive vs. Proactive Living: Taking Back Control of Your Time

If your days feel like one big emergency, it’s time to shift from reactive mode to intentional Christian time management. Learn how to set clear priorities so your schedule aligns with your God-given calling and learn how to stop wasting time in the process.
